Subject: The mechitza model

Let me try a different approach.

For practical purposes, gender in traditional Jewish contexts often means: which side of the mechitza do you sit on?

This is not metaphysics. It is not Talmudic categorization. It is a simple observable fact about how a person navigates Jewish space.

G:M — I sit in the men's section G:F — I sit in the women's section G:x — I decline to state, or this does not apply to me

This sidesteps the question of what gender "is." It captures only what a person does.
